The message trust is a Christ centered project which does a lot of different things for the local and wider communities of Manchester and the UK. At Whythenshaw, they have a coffee shop that produces really good coffee and a large seating area with welcoming staff and a warm environment, a food bank for the people who live locally and a Christ centered church which I would encourage anyone to attend who is searching for answers to life or looking for a God fearing church to go to that supports you in your journey to becoming more Christ- like but does not judge you for being a broken person who makes mistakes along the way. 7 day a week church. There is always something happening here, free groups and classes for all ages. A community grocery and cafe.

But most importantly, a great Sunday service at 11:30 with a band, powerful speakers, and life changing messages from the bible.

Extremely open and welcoming to all from the community, old and young, so you'll get to know many new people. There is also chance to get talking to new people after the service with a tea/coffee and cake.
